BLOOMINGTON, Ind.-- The RedHawks put together a strong showing at the Billy Hayes Invitational Friday with many top-10 finishes in both the track and field.

 

HOW IT HAPPENED:

  • On the field, Ryan Smith finished in fourth place in the men's discus throw with 50.58 meters. Smith also competed in the men's hammer throw event and finished in third place with 55.66 meters. Smith (15.89m) and Ben Riegel (15.82m) finished in fourth and fifth place in the men's shot put event.
  • In the men's 110m hurdle finals, Eman Alfred finished in third place with a time of 14.68 seconds. In the men's 400m dash, Leo Bouldin finished in fourth place with a time of 48.68 seconds. Jacob Ranker finished in third place in the men's 400m hurdles with a time of 52.20 seconds, John Wetula (56.86) and Joshua Mikulka (59.34) also finished in eighth and 10th place. Jayson Harrison finished in fifth place in the men's 200m dash with a time of 21.99 seconds.
  • In the men's 1500m, Jake Bertelsen finished in fifth place with a time of 3:47.96.  
  • In the women's 100m hurdle finals, Kayla Walters finished in first place with a time of 13.98 seconds! Sydney Harmon also finished in fifth place with a time of 14.94 seconds. In the women's 100m dash finals, Alanah Owens finished in ninth place with a time of 12.41 seconds. Nora Zubillaga finished in second place in the women's 800m dash with a time of 2:13.42. In the women's 400m hurdle finals, Gabby Cossio finished in second place with a time of 1:02.56 seconds. Abby Suszek finished in fourth place in the women's 200m dash with a time of 24.86 seconds. Owens also finished in eighth place in the 200m dash with a time of 25.69 seconds. 
  • Julia Rushing (4:37.37) and Jenna Sayle (4:41.57) finished in eighth and 11th place in the women's 1500m. The women's 4x400 team of Suszek, Cossio, Rachel Smith, and Zubillaga finished in second place with a time of 3:49.15.
  • On the field, Ella Rigel (54.32m) and Addison Hoover (47.63m) finished in fourth and sixth place in the women's hammer throw. In the women's javelin throw event, Allie Melchiorre finished in third place with 39.28 meters. In the women's high jump event, Elle Miller finished in fifth place with 1.65 meters.

WHAT'S NEXT:

The RedHawks start the postseason next weekend with the MAC championship in Akron beginning Thursday, May 11.
